Output f0864e2151ef847dd6ad7cb30d2db91b0e5d7f484a934b54345adb6497969302:28

value
335794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 185c64940671328dd793edad915eb29357766607 OP_EQUAL
address
33uppiat7Hrx4G6iH6Ew75KfHFSAjyKB5G
transaction
f0864e2151ef847dd6ad7cb30d2db91b0e5d7f484a934b54345adb6497969302
spent
true